Dr Samatha Backhaus explains the brain, it funtioning parts and NON-funtioning parts recorded from inside my personal origional Brain Injury Coping Skills (BICS) classes.   I'm  hospitalized (yet the show must go on, and since THE show is titled under my name- well...), following MAJOR by-pass surgery last Thursday (93 damned staples worth).  Its the beginning of my "Brain Injury Radio Hospital Tour", with next week's (or three) coming from the to-be current stay at the Rehabilitation Hospital of Indiana.  I was fooled at first (dagnabbed TBI), but RHI is where my return to life found it's footing (Or at least the building where  I learned my name, eventually - after 'sleeping for 54 days in 2008!).  A quote from one of the smartest men I know - "work hard to play hard and have fun.  Don't ever quit - believing or on 'the team'.....
